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ations
Choosing the right chainsaw sharpening file kit depends on how you typically work, the pitch and type of your chain, and where you sharpen most often. Consider the following factors to compare options effectively:
- Chain pitch and size compatibility: Ensure the round file sizes match your chains’ pitch and tooth count. Kits that include multiple sizes offer greater versatility for different chains.
- Included guides and gauges: A durable file guide and depth gauge improve sharpening accuracy and help maintain consistent cutting angles across sessions.
- Portability vs. completeness: Compact kits with a travel pouch are ideal for field work, while larger sets with many files and accessories suit a home shop.
- Material quality and durability: Look for high-quality carbon steel or hardened files for longer life and less frequent replacements.
- Ergonomics and comfort: A comfortable handle reduces fatigue during longer sharpening sessions, especially when you work on multiple chains.
- Organization and storage: A case or pouch that keeps files, gauges, and guides organized saves time and protects tools.
- Beginner friendliness: Sets that include instruction sheets or quick-start guides help new users learn proper sharpening angles and techniques.
Performance considerations also include how easy it is to achieve consistent depth gauge settings and whether the kit covers common chain sizes used in consumer and professional saws. For people with multiple saws or different chain standards, a universal or broad-size kit can simplify maintenance. Conversely, specialized kits tailored to a specific brand or pitch may offer slightly faster setup and more precise results for that system.
Practical usage tips: start with a clean chain, inspect for damaged teeth, and use light, consistent strokes when filing. Regular maintenance, rather than infrequent heavy sharpening, tends to yield better cutting performance and longer chain life.
